Which gauges?

Oil Pressure - get this adapter, remove std oil pressure switch and re fit with this and the new sender.

boost, just tee off a pipe on the inlet manifold after the throttle body.

I have used both adaptors as 500 has linked above.
The 1st link, oil pressure adaptor also has the benefit of fitting your exsisting oil pressure sensor as well as the defi sensor. That way you wont have the oil pressure symbol light up on your dash.

The oil temp adaptor is simple to fit once you have removed the hex bolt from the engine block (cyl 3).

Just make sure you use pft tape on the threads of the adaptors & sensors to avoid oil leaks.
